Overview
This small volume brings together more than fifty of the best-loved devotional poems in English, suitable for contemplative reading or prayer. The poems have been taken from many traditions--mostly Christian, but also from Oriental and Islamic sources. They include mystical poets of the distant past as well as contemporary authors such as Stephen Spender, Thomas Merton and e.e. cummings. The poems themselves are gathered under three different headings--reflecting the journey to God, the times of human life, and heroes and heroines.
